Sloan's Lake

Lake views, newer townhomes, and a west-of-downtown feel.

Overview

Sloan's Lake centers on the largest lake in Denver, with a 2.6-mile path looping the water and steady residential redevelopment around the perimeter.

Buyers consider it for views (lake, downtown skyline, and Front Range in many cases), proximity to both downtown and I-70 toward the mountains, and a still-evolving mix of new construction and original housing stock.

Homes & Housing Styles

Historic bungalows on the surrounding blocks are mixed with a heavy wave of modern townhomes and mid-rise condos closer to the lake. Single-family infill builds appear on tear-down lots block by block.

View orientation — to the lake, to downtown, or both — is one of the biggest pricing variables in newer product.

Lifestyle, Parks & Local Amenities

Sloan's Lake Park itself is the centerpiece, with a wide loop path, multiple playgrounds, picnic areas, and paddle-friendly water in season. The broader Denver park and trail network is a short ride away.

Edgewater Public Market sits just across the western boundary and handles a lot of everyday dining, drinks, and groceries. The 17th Avenue corridor and pockets along Sheridan add local restaurants and coffee.

Lakeside running and biking, seasonal paddle sports, and a steadily growing small-business base around the lake's perimeter.

Location & Everyday Convenience

Quick access to I-25, downtown, and I-70 toward the mountains. Light rail is reachable at the Decatur-Federal station; bus service runs along the major surrounding streets.

Advisory

What Sellers Should Know

Lake-view and skyline-view units price differently than non-view units in the same building or block — make sure comparables reflect actual exposure, not just address.

For townhomes and condos, lead with what buyers actually shop for here: view orientation, rooftop deck quality, parking, and finish level. Floorplan flow matters more than headline square footage.

Advisory

What Buyers Should Compare

Newer townhomes vary widely in construction quality, sound transmission, and HOA structure. Compare developer track record and any party-wall details carefully.

View corridors are not guaranteed — surrounding parcels can redevelop and change what you see from upper floors. Confirm zoning and any planned projects nearby before paying a view premium.
